Analysis
In 2025, general government final consumption expenditure (current us$), per in Serbia stood at 0.1847 current US$ per US$ of GDP.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 5.6% on the previous year and up 1.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, general government final consumption expenditure (current us$), per in Serbia peaked at 0.2785 current US$ per US$ of GDP in 2003 and was at its lowest, 0.1713 current US$ per US$ of GDP, in 2023.
Serbia ranks 72nd of 187 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 31 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
General government final consumption expenditure (current US$)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
General government final consumption expenditure (current US$) ÷ GDP (current US$)
